Tämä opas käsittelee ylläpidon asetuksia, pelaajien hallintaa, maailman hallintaa ja vianmääritystä TerraTech Worlds -omistuspalvelimellasi Legion Hostingissa. Palvelimen alkuasennusta, maailman asetuksia ja yhdistämisohjeita varten katso TerraTech Worlds -palvelimen asennusopas.
Ylläpidon asetukset
TerraTech Worlds -omistuspalvelimet käyttävät Steam ID -tunnuksia tai salasanapohjaista järjestelmää ylläpitäjien käyttöoikeuksien hallintaan. Palvelimen omistaja voi nimetä ylläpitäjiä, joilla on korotetut oikeudet palvelimen hallintaan.
Ylläpitäjän käyttöoikeuksien määrittäminen
- Pysäytä palvelimesi GPanelissa.
- Siirry Files-välilehdelle ja paikanna palvelimen määritystiedosto.
- Lisää ylläpitäjämerkinnät määrittämällä pelaajien Steam ID -tunnukset ylläpitäjälistaan tai asettamalla ylläpitäjän salasana.
- Tallenna tiedosto ja käynnistä palvelin uudelleen.
Pelaajan Steam ID -tunnuksen löytäminen
Voit löytää pelaajan Steam64 ID -tunnuksen:
- Käymällä hänen Steam-profiilissaan ja käyttämällä Steam ID -hakutyökalua (kuten steamid.io).
- Tarkistamalla palvelimen konsolin tulosteen, kun pelaaja yhdistää — yhteyslokit sisältävät tyypillisesti Steam ID -tunnukset.
Ylläpitokomennot
Ylläpitokomennot voidaan suorittaa GPanel-palvelinkonsolin kautta tai pelin sisäisten ylläpitäjien toimesta chat-komennoilla. Seuraavassa taulukossa luetellaan yleisesti käytetyt ylläpitokomennot:
| Komento | Kuvaus |
|---|---|
kick <player> |
Potkii pelaajan ulos palvelimelta. Hän voi yhdistää uudelleen välittömästi. |
ban <player> |
Bannaa pelaajan palvelimelta. Säilyy uudelleenkäynnistysten yli. |
unban <player> |
Poistaa pelaajan bannin. |
players / list |
Listaa kaikki tällä hetkellä yhteydessä olevat pelaajat tunnuksineen. |
save |
Pakottaa välittömän maailman tallennuksen. |
say <message> |
Lähettää palvelimenlaajuisen ilmoitusviestin. |
shutdown |
Sammuttaa palvelimen hallitusti tallentaen maailman ensin. |
help |
Listaa kaikki käytettävissä olevat palvelinkomennot. |
help-komentoa konsolissa nähdäksesi kaikki tällä hetkellä tuetut komennot.
Pelaajien hallinta
Potkiminen ja bannaaminen
Käytä kick- ja ban-komentoja häiritsevien pelaajien hallintaan:
- Kick: Katkaisee pelaajan yhteyden välittömästi. Hän voi liittyä uudelleen, ellei häntä ole myös bannattu.
- Ban: Katkaisee pelaajan yhteyden ja estää häntä yhdistämästä uudelleen. Bannit säilyvät palvelimen uudelleenkäynnistysten yli.
- Unban: Käytä
unban-komentoa pelaajan nimen tai tunnuksen kanssa bannin poistamiseksi.
Bannilistan hallinta
Bannatut pelaajat tallennetaan bannilistatiedostoon palvelimen hakemistossa. Voit muokata tätä tiedostoa manuaalisesti GPanelin Files-välilehden kautta lisätäksesi tai poistaaksesi merkintöjä:
- Pysäytä palvelin.
- Avaa bannilistatiedosto Files-välilehdellä.
- Lisää tai poista Steam ID -tunnuksia tarpeen mukaan.
- Tallenna ja käynnistä palvelin uudelleen.
Sallittujen lista (valinnainen)
Jos haluat rajoittaa palvelimesi vain tietyille pelaajille, voit käyttää sallittujen listaa (whitelist). Kun se on käytössä, vain pelaajat, joiden Steam ID -tunnukset ovat sallittujen listalla, voivat liittyä palvelimelle. Tarkista sallittujen listan asetukset palvelimen määritystiedostosta.
Maailman hallinta
Maailman tallentaminen
Palvelin tallentaa maailman automaattisesti säännöllisin väliajoin ja hallitun sammutuksen yhteydessä. Voit myös pakottaa manuaalisen tallennuksen:
- Käytä
save-komentoa GPanel-konsolissa käynnistääksesi välittömän tallennuksen. - Pysäytä palvelin aina hallitusti (GPanelin Stop-painikkeella) varmistaaksesi, että maailma tallennetaan ennen sammutusta.
Maailman varmuuskopiointi
Säännölliset varmuuskopiot suojaavat tietojen menetykseltä vioittumisen, vahingossa tapahtuvan poiston tai ei-toivottujen muutosten varalta:
- Pysäytä palvelin varmistaaksesi yhtenäisen tallennustilan.
- Siirry Files-välilehdelle ja paikanna maailman tallennushakemisto.
- Lataa koko tallennuskansio Files-välilehden tai SFTP:n kautta.
- Tallenna varmuuskopio paikallisesti. Harkitse varmuuskopioiden merkitsemistä päivämäärillä helppoa tunnistamista varten.
Varmuuskopion palauttaminen
- Pysäytä palvelin.
- Lataa varmuuskopiosi tallennustiedostot oikeaan hakemistoon korvaten olemassa olevat tiedostot.
- Käynnistä palvelin. Palautettu maailma latautuu.
Maailman nollaaminen
Aloittaaksesi alusta uudella maailmalla:
- Pysäytä palvelin.
- Varmuuskopioi olemassa oleva maailman tallennus, jos haluat säilyttää sen.
- Poista maailman tallennuskansio.
- Vaihda halutessasi
WORLD_SEEDStartup-välilehdellä saadaksesi erilaisen maailman asettelun. - Käynnistä palvelin. Uusi maailma generoidaan.
Maailman kasvu ajan myötä
Kun pelaajat tutkivat ja muokkaavat maailmaa, tallennustiedoston koko kasvaa. Tämä on normaalia käyttäytymistä:
- Tutkitut alueet (chunkit) tallennetaan levylle, mikä lisää tallennustilan käyttöä.
- Pelaajien rakennelmat ja Techit lisäävät maailman dataa.
- Seuraa levynkäyttöä GPanelissa. Jos lähestyt tallennusrajaasi, harkitse käyttämättömien alueiden siivoamista tai tukipyynnön avaamista vaihtoehtojen pohtimiseksi.
Vianmääritys
Palvelin ei käynnisty
- Tarkista GPanel-konsoli virheilmoitusten varalta käynnistyksen aikana.
- Varmista, etteivät palvelintiedostot ole vioittuneet. Uudelleenasennus Startup-välilehdeltä voi korjata puuttuvia tai vahingoittuneita tiedostoja.
- Varmista, ettei määritysvirheitä ole — virheellisesti muotoiltu määritystiedosto voi estää palvelimen käynnistymisen.
- Jos palvelin toimi aiemmin eikä nyt käynnisty, kokeile palauttaa maailman tallennuksen varmuuskopio siltä varalta, että tallennustiedosto on vioittunut.
Pelaajat eivät voi yhdistää
- Varmista, että palvelin on käynnistynyt täysin ja on online-tilassa GPanelissa.
- Jos se on salasanasuojattu, varmista, että pelaajat syöttävät oikean salasanan.
- Varmista, että peliversio täsmää — palvelimen ja asiakasohjelman on oltava samassa versiossa. Päivitä palvelin pelin päivitysten jälkeen.
- Pyydä pelaajia kokeilemaan suoraa yhdistämistä IP-osoitteen ja portin avulla. Katso Palvelimen IP-osoitteen ja portin löytäminen.
- Tarkista, onko pelaaja bannattu (joko tarkoituksella tai vahingossa).
Suorituskykyongelmat
- Tarkista GPanelin resurssikaaviot suorittimen ja RAM-muistin käytön osalta.
- Vähennä pelaajien enimmäismäärää, jos palvelin on jatkuvasti raskaan kuormituksen alla.
- Pelaajien rakentamat suuret, monimutkaiset Techit lisäävät simulaation työmäärää. Kannusta pelaajia pitämään Techien koot kohtuullisina vilkkailla palvelimilla.
- Erittäin suuri maailma laajalla tutkimushistorialla käyttää enemmän muistia. Harkitse uuden maailman aloittamista ajoittain, jos suorituskyky heikkenee merkittävästi ajan myötä.
- Jos resurssien käyttö on jatkuvasti rajalla, harkitse palvelinpakettisi päivittämistä. Avaa tukipyyntö vaihtoehtojen pohtimiseksi.
Maailman tallennuksen vioittuminen
- Jos palvelin ei lataa maailmaa kaatumisen jälkeen, tallennus voi olla vioittunut.
- Palauta tuoreesta varmuuskopiosta (katso Varmuuskopion palauttaminen yllä).
- Jos varmuuskopiota ei ole saatavilla, saatat joutua poistamaan tallennuksen ja aloittamaan uuden maailman.
- Vioittumisen estämiseksi pysäytä palvelin aina hallitusti ja harkitse säännöllisten varmuuskopioiden ajastamista.
Versioristiriita päivitysten jälkeen
- Kun TerraTech Worlds saa päivityksen, palvelimen ja kaikkien pelaajien on oltava samassa versiossa.
- Pysäytä palvelin ja käynnistä päivitys/uudelleenasennus Startup-välilehdeltä uusimpien palvelintiedostojen noutamiseksi.
- Pelaajien tulee päivittää pelinsä Steamin kautta ennen uudelleenyhdistämistä.
- Tarkista GPanel-konsoli käynnistyksessä palvelimen version varmistamiseksi.
Aiheeseen liittyvät artikkelit
- TerraTech Worlds -palvelimen asennusopas — Alkuasennus, maailman asetukset, määritykset ja yhdistämisohjeet
- Palvelimen IP-osoitteen ja portin löytäminen
- Tiedostojen lataaminen SFTP:n kautta
- Palvelimen käynnistysopas — Yleinen opas minkä tahansa pelipalvelimen käynnistämiseen Legion Hostingissa
Tarvitsetko lisäapua?
Jos kohtaat ongelmia, joita tämä opas ei kata, tukitiimimme on käytettävissä auttamaan. Avaa tukipyyntö osoitteessa legionhosting.net/submitticket.php palvelimesi tiedoilla, ongelman kuvauksella ja kaikilla olennaisilla virheilmoituksilla GPanel-konsolista.